This research is based on the application of punishment in improving students' morals, this is marked by the morals of students who like to come in when the teacher is explaining the lesson and also students who like to talk to friends when the teacher is explaining in front of the class, if this continues to be allowed then students will not understand the importance of having good morals, researchers feel it is very important to conduct research on the application of punishment in an effort to improve students' morals. The type of research used is descriptive qualitative, key informants are teachers and students and supporting informants are the principal. Data collection methods are observation and interview methods. Data analysis techniques used to examine all data, data reduction and data display. This study shows that students who come in and out when the teacher explains the lesson and talk when the teacher explains the lesson in the actions that the teacher will give to students are through notifications, reprimands, warnings and the last action taken by the teacher is to give punishment, and there are also forms of student morals that show the nature of lying, arrogant, betrayal, arrogance and envy with this the teacher will give punishment to students so that they can improve student morals into good morals by giving this punishment the teacher hopes that students will understand the importance of having good morals.
